如何优化centos上的composer性能
在 CentOS 系统下优化 Composer 性能,可以采取以下措施:
-
安装 Composer 依赖项: 确保已经安装了 PHP、Composer 以及 PHP 的扩展。可以使用以下命令安装 Composer:
curl -sS https://getcomposer.org/installer | php mv composer.phar /usr/local/bin/composer
-
使用 Composer 自动加载优化: Composer 提供了一个自动加载生成器,可以帮助优化代码的加载速度。在项目根目录下运行以下命令:
composer dump-autoload --optimize
-
使用 PHP OPcache: PHP OPcache 可以缓存已编译的字节码,从而提高 PHP 脚本的执行速度。要启用 OPcache,请按照以下步骤操作:
- 安装 PHP OPcache 扩展:
sudo yum install php-opcache
- 启用 OPcache:
echo "opcache.enable=1" | sudo tee /etc/php.d/opcache.ini echo "opcache.memory_consumption=64" | sudo tee -a /etc/php.d/opcache.ini echo "opcache.max_accelerated_files=10000" | sudo tee -a /etc/php.d/opcache.ini echo "opcache.revalidate_freq=2" | sudo tee -a /etc/php.d/opcache.ini
- 重启 Web 服务器以应用更改。
- 安装 PHP OPcache 扩展:
-
使用 PHP 7.x 或更高版本: 升级到 PHP 7.x 或更高版本可以提高性能。可以通过以下命令检查当前 PHP 版本:
php -v
如果需要升级 PHP,请参考 CentOS 官方文档或采用其他方法进行升级。
-
使用负载均衡和服务器集群: 如果项目访问量很大,可以考虑使用负载均衡和服务器集群来分摊请求压力,从而提高整体性能。
-
使用缓存技术: 为网站添加缓存层,如使用 Redis 或 Memcached 作为缓存存储,可以显著提高响应速度。
-
优化数据库查询: 优化数据库查询可以减轻服务器负担,提高网站性能。可以使用 MySQL 查询优化器和其他数据库优化工具来实现。
-
使用 CDN(内容分发网络): 使用 CDN 可以将静态资源(如图片、CSS 和 JavaScript 文件)分发到全球各地的服务器上,从而减少服务器负担,提高访问速度。
请注意,在进行任何优化操作之前,建议备份重要数据,并在测试环境中验证优化效果,以确保不会对系统稳定性和安全性产生负面影响。
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权请联系我们,一经查实立即删除!